pgAdmin 4's Import/Export Data tool builds a psql \copy (...) command line by interpolating a user-supplied SQL query into a Jinja template and passing the rendered line to psql via --command. To stop an attacker from breaking out of the (...) wrapper, create_import_export_job() (route POST /import_export/job/<sid>, gated only by the ordinary, commonly-granted tools_import_export_data permission) validated the query with a hand-written parenthesis-balance checker, _is_query_parens_balanced(). That checker always treated a backslash before a single quote (\') as escaping the quote, i.e. as if standard_conforming_strings were off. PostgreSQL has defaulted standard_conforming_strings to on since 9.1 (2010), the default on every PostgreSQL version pgAdmin 4 currently supports (13-18); under that default psql's own \copy tokenizer treats \ as an ordinary character, so a single quote immediately after it closes the string literal. A query such as SELECT 'a\') TO PROGRAM 'echo pwned' x' was therefore accepted as "balanced" by pgAdmin's checker (which believed the ) was still inside the string), while psql, run through the actual rendered command line, closes the string at that point and treats the following ) as the end of the wrapping \copy (...) subquery, exposing an attacker-chosen TO PROGRAM '<command>' clause that psql executes via popen() -- independent of a subsequent syntax error later on the same line. This is the same class of bug as CVE-2025-12762/CVE-2025-13780 (RCE via psql meta-command/COPY injection during PLAIN-format dump restore), reached through an independently written defense in a different module (Import/Export Data rather than Restore) that had its own, different logic bug (inverted backslash-escape semantics rather than a BOM-defeated regex anchor).
The fix rejects any backslash inside a single-quoted string in the query outright, rather than picking one of the two possible psql interpretations. This is intentionally conservative: because the correct interpretation of \ depends on the target server's standard_conforming_strings setting, which the checker cannot reliably know at validation time, refusing the query is safer than guessing.
This issue affects pgAdmin 4: from the introduction of _is_query_parens_balanced() before 9.18.
CVSS Vector: CVSS:3.1/AV:N/AC:L/PR:L/UI:N/S:C/C:H/I:H/A:H
CVSS Score: 9.9
Threat model: same as CVE-2025-12762/13780. An authenticated pgAdmin user (server mode) holding only the ordinary, routinely-granted "Import/Export Data" tool permission (tools_import_export_data) -- not an admin-only permission -- submits a single crafted POST to /import_export/job/<sid> with is_query_export true and a query field containing the payload. No further user interaction, no special server-side configuration, and no elevated pgAdmin role is required. Successful exploitation runs an arbitrary OS command as the pgAdmin application server's service account, which is a privilege escalation beyond anything the Import/Export Data permission is meant to grant (database-query access, not host command execution) -- Scope Changed. Impact is full compromise of the pgAdmin host (C/I/A: High).

CVSS Vector: CVSS:4.0/AV:N/AC:L/AT:N/PR:L/UI:N/VC:H/VI:H/VA:H/SC:H/SI:H/SA:H
CVSS Score: 9.4
Same reasoning as the CVSS 3.1 entry: network-reachable, low privilege required, no user interaction, host RCE compromises both pgAdmin's own authority (SC/SI/SA: High) and the underlying system data/integrity/availability (VC/VI/VA: High).
